The British Council Japan is delighted to announce that they are launching the 'Summer English Language Study in the UK Programme' targeting high school students in Japan. UK institutions accredited by Accreditation UK are invited to tender to participate in this programme that will place approximately 70 students in UK centres.
What do the classic second language acquisition case studies have to help teachers in the classroom? How can teachers get out of their rut and invigorate lessons with something new? How can teachers help students settle, and does early emphasis on tenses hinder those learning English?
All these questions, and many more, were discussed during English UK's annual Teachers' Conference.
Steve Phillips has taken over as chair of the board of English UK. He replaces Sarah Cooper, who stepped down as chair after 18 months in the post.
